The Pathfinder is a magnificent car with all the handling and comfort anyone should want or need in a mid- sized SUV. Plus, I pull both a heavy boat and a car trailer. The 6 Cyl engine is plenty and it has all the towing power and handling with a trailer, yet still gets better gas mileage than most other SUVs when empty! I use 87 Octane and do fine. These are such great cars that my 40 year old son traded his Tahoe and bought a 2010 Pathfinder also!

Just paid off and traded in my 2005 Pathfinder with 116,000 miles and got the same model. Had no problems with it and the previous 2001 at 130,000 miles. My wife loves the new one, because of the interior comfort and new techno updates such as "keyless". The Pathfinder does not get the best milage, but I average 19 to 20 MPG with 70% freeway driving. Plenty of room for 4 passengers and all their suitcases and laptops. Doubles as an excellent vehicle for my outdoor pursuits. It is not a race car and driven sensibly it tracks on snow and ice like a champ with the auto. Excellent amenities compared to competition, which I always look at and then go back to Pathfinder.

We traded in our 2006 3.5L V6 Nissan Altima, and decided to stay will Nissan as our Altima gave us no problems. So we went to our local dealer and they said that they didn't have any Pathfinders in our color or trim level (SE). So we placed a deposit and the next day we got our Pathfinder. I have to admit, I love this SUV, we took the car on an 800 Mile road trip, the day after we got it. The car drove smoothly and was extremely quiet. Fuel economy is not great, however we are getting more than the EPA estimate. The SUV is great but there are some quality issues with this SUV. The materials feel and look cheap and the dashboard panels are misaligned. Other than that, We love our Pathfinder!
